/* TRUNCATED DIVISION BY SMALL INTEGERS
1041
 
1042
   We are interested in q(x) = floor(x/y), where x >= 0 and y > 0
1043
   (with y fixed).
1044
 
1045
   Let a = floor(z/y), for some choice of z.  Note that z will be
1046
   chosen so that division by z is cheap.
1047
 
1048
   Let r be the remainder(z/y).  In other words, r = z - ay.
1049
 
1050
   Now, our method is to choose a value for b such that
1051
 
1052
   q'(x) = floor((ax+b)/z)
1053
 
1054
   is equal to q(x) over as large a range of x as possible.  If the
1055
   two are equal over a sufficiently large range, and if it is easy to
1056
   form the product (ax), and it is easy to divide by z, then we can
1057
   perform the division much faster than the general division algorithm.
1058
 
1059
   So, we want the following to be true:
1060
 
1061
   .    For x in the following range:
1062
   .
1063
   .        ky <= x < (k+1)y
1064
   .
1065
   .    implies that
1066
   .
1067
   .        k <= (ax+b)/z < (k+1)
1068
 
1069
   We want to determine b such that this is true for all k in the
1070
   range {0..K} for some maximum K.
1071
 
1072
   Since (ax+b) is an increasing function of x, we can take each
1073
   bound separately to determine the "best" value for b.
1074
 
1075
   (ax+b)/z < (k+1)            implies
1076
 
1077
   (a((k+1)y-1)+b < (k+1)z     implies
1078
 
1079
   b < a + (k+1)(z-ay)         implies
1080
 
1081
   b < a + (k+1)r
1082
 
1083
   This needs to be true for all k in the range {0..K}.  In
1084
   particular, it is true for k = 0 and this leads to a maximum
1085
   acceptable value for b.
1086
 
1087
   b < a+r   or   b <= a+r-1
1088
 
1089
   Taking the other bound, we have
1090
 
1091
   k <= (ax+b)/z               implies
1092
 
1093
   k <= (aky+b)/z              implies
1094
 
1095
   k(z-ay) <= b                implies
1096
 
1097
   kr <= b
1098
 
1099
   Clearly, the largest range for k will be achieved by maximizing b,
1100
   when r is not zero.  When r is zero, then the simplest choice for b
1101
   is 0.  When r is not 0, set
1102
 
1103
   .    b = a+r-1
1104
 
1105
   Now, by construction, q'(x) = floor((ax+b)/z) = q(x) = floor(x/y)
1106
   for all x in the range:
1107
 
1108
   .    0 <= x < (K+1)y
1109
 
1110
   We need to determine what K is.  Of our two bounds,
1111
 
1112
   .    b < a+(k+1)r	is satisfied for all k >= 0, by construction.
1113
 
1114
   The other bound is
1115
 
1116
   .    kr <= b
1117
 
1118
   This is always true if r = 0.  If r is not 0 (the usual case), then
1119
   K = floor((a+r-1)/r), is the maximum value for k.
1120
 
1121
   Therefore, the formula q'(x) = floor((ax+b)/z) yields the correct
1122
   answer for q(x) = floor(x/y) when x is in the range
1123
 
1124
   (0,(K+1)y-1)        K = floor((a+r-1)/r)
1125
 
1126
   To be most useful, we want (K+1)y-1 = (max x) >= 2**32-1 so that
1127
   the formula for q'(x) yields the correct value of q(x) for all x
1128
   representable by a single word in HPPA.
1129
 
1130
   We are also constrained in that computing the product (ax), adding
1131
   b, and dividing by z must all be done quickly, otherwise we will be
1132
   better off going through the general algorithm using the DS
1133
   instruction, which uses approximately 70 cycles.
1134
 
1135
   For each y, there is a choice of z which satisfies the constraints
1136
   for (K+1)y >= 2**32.  We may not, however, be able to satisfy the
1137
   timing constraints for arbitrary y.  It seems that z being equal to
1138
   a power of 2 or a power of 2 minus 1 is as good as we can do, since
1139
   it minimizes the time to do division by z.  We want the choice of z
1140
   to also result in a value for (a) that minimizes the computation of
1141
   the product (ax).  This is best achieved if (a) has a regular bit
1142
   pattern (so the multiplication can be done with shifts and adds).
1143
   The value of (a) also needs to be less than 2**32 so the product is
1144
   always guaranteed to fit in 2 words.
1145
 
1146
   In actual practice, the following should be done:
1147
 
1148
   1) For negative x, you should take the absolute value and remember
1149
   .  the fact so that the result can be negated.  This obviously does
1150
   .  not apply in the unsigned case.
1151
   2) For even y, you should factor out the power of 2 that divides y
1152
   .  and divide x by it.  You can then proceed by dividing by the
1153
   .  odd factor of y.
1154
 
1155
   Here is a table of some odd values of y, and corresponding choices
1156
   for z which are "good".
1157
 
1158
    y     z       r      a (hex)     max x (hex)
1159
 
1160
    3   2**32     1     55555555      100000001
1161
    5   2**32     1     33333333      100000003
1162
    7  2**24-1    0       249249     (infinite)
1163
    9  2**24-1    0       1c71c7     (infinite)
1164
   11  2**20-1    0        1745d     (infinite)
1165
   13  2**24-1    0       13b13b     (infinite)
1166
   15   2**32     1     11111111      10000000d
1167
   17   2**32     1      f0f0f0f      10000000f
1168
 
1169
   If r is 1, then b = a+r-1 = a.  This simplifies the computation
1170
   of (ax+b), since you can compute (x+1)(a) instead.  If r is 0,
1171
   then b = 0 is ok to use which simplifies (ax+b).
1172
 
1173
   The bit patterns for 55555555, 33333333, and 11111111 are obviously
1174
   very regular.  The bit patterns for the other values of a above are:
1175
 
1176
    y      (hex)          (binary)
1177
 
1178
    7     249249  001001001001001001001001  << regular >>
1179
    9     1c71c7  000111000111000111000111  << regular >>
1180
   11      1745d  000000010111010001011101  << irregular >>
1181
   13     13b13b  000100111011000100111011  << irregular >>
1182
 
1183
   The bit patterns for (a) corresponding to (y) of 11 and 13 may be
1184
   too irregular to warrant using this method.
1185
 
1186
   When z is a power of 2 minus 1, then the division by z is slightly
1187
   more complicated, involving an iterative solution.
1188
 
1189
   The code presented here solves division by 1 through 17, except for
1190
   11 and 13. There are algorithms for both signed and unsigned
1191
   quantities given.
1192
 
1193
   TIMINGS (cycles)
1194
 
1195
   divisor  positive  negative  unsigned
1196
 
1197
   .   1        2          2         2
1198
   .   2        4          4         2
1199
   .   3       19         21        19
1200
   .   4        4          4         2
1201
   .   5       18         22        19
1202
   .   6       19         22        19
1203
   .   8        4          4         2
1204
   .  10       18         19        17
1205
   .  12       18         20        18
1206
   .  15       16         18        16
1207
   .  16        4          4         2
1208
   .  17       16         18        16
1209
 
1210
   Now, the algorithm for 7, 9, and 14 is an iterative one.  That is,
1211
   a loop body is executed until the tentative quotient is 0.  The
1212
   number of times the loop body is executed varies depending on the
1213
   dividend, but is never more than two times.  If the dividend is
1214
   less than the divisor, then the loop body is not executed at all.
1215
   Each iteration adds 4 cycles to the timings.
1216
 
1217
   divisor  positive  negative  unsigned
1218
 
1219
   .   7       19+4n     20+4n     20+4n    n = number of iterations
1220
   .   9       21+4n     22+4n     21+4n
1221
   .  14       21+4n     22+4n     20+4n
1222
 
1223
   To give an idea of how the number of iterations varies, here is a
1224
   table of dividend versus number of iterations when dividing by 7.
1225
 
1226
   smallest      largest       required
1227
   dividend     dividend      iterations
1228
 
1229
   .    0             6              0
1230
   .    7        0x6ffffff          1
1231
   0x1000006    0xffffffff          2
1232
 
1233
   There is some overlap in the range of numbers requiring 1 and 2
1234
   iterations.  */

/* DIVISION BY DIVISORS OF FFFFFF, and powers of 2 times these
1513
   includes 7,9 and also 14
1514
 
1515
 
1516
   z = 2**24-1
1517
   r = z mod x = 0
1518
 
1519
   so choose b = 0
1520
 
1521
   Also, in order to divide by z = 2**24-1, we approximate by dividing
1522
   by (z+1) = 2**24 (which is easy), and then correcting.
1523
 
1524
   (ax) = (z+1)q' + r
1525
   .    = zq' + (q'+r)
1526
 
1527
   So to compute (ax)/z, compute q' = (ax)/(z+1) and r = (ax) mod (z+1)
1528
   Then the true remainder of (ax)/z is (q'+r).  Repeat the process
1529
   with this new remainder, adding the tentative quotients together,
1530
   until a tentative quotient is 0 (and then we are done).  There is
1531
   one last correction to be done.  It is possible that (q'+r) = z.
1532
   If so, then (q'+r)/(z+1) = 0 and it looks like we are done.  But,
1533
   in fact, we need to add 1 more to the quotient.  Now, it turns
1534
   out that this happens if and only if the original value x is
1535
   an exact multiple of y.  So, to avoid a three instruction test at
1536
   the end, instead use 1 instruction to add 1 to x at the beginning.  */
